Output ea28768d2c716c29dec6d129e929ee0172a45d6b00aaea750c3d4e542fc6976b:14

value
22938679
script pubkey
OP_0 OP_PUSHBYTES_32 94020ac99a78fe58ffe6d4617448d10d5540e5e772050acec1528af6f5292fce
address
bc1qjspq4jv60rl93llx63shgjx3p425pe08wgzs4nkp2290daff9l8queyv90
transaction
ea28768d2c716c29dec6d129e929ee0172a45d6b00aaea750c3d4e542fc6976b
spent
true